Does Your Grout Grubby? How To Refresh Ceramic Properly
That mottled grout between your ceramic surfaces is probably a sign of dirt and accumulated buildup. Don't ignoring it! A simple cleaning can really improve the appearance. Start by sweeping away loose debris. Then, create a solution of white vinegar and water. Apply the blend to the grout, let it sit for several minutes, and wipe with a brush. Remove thoroughly and permit it to dry. For tougher stains, consider a commercial cleaner or possibly a specialized equipment.
